The current Southwest Pacific wind flow map is showing several active low-pressure systems. Nothing new of concern for NZ for now but followers from the tropics need to keep an eye on 2 of these systems currently over Australian waters.
1. Ex-tropical low 94P now moving southward and deepening as a mid-latitude cyclonic cut off low between the South Island and Chatham Islands. This will bring showery and windy west to south-westerly over the upper North Island during the weekend.
2. Tropical cyclone 16P is becoming subtropical SE of New Caledonia steering along the subtropical ridge away from NZ waters. Its set to dissolve over the weekend as it meets hostile upper-level wind shear.
3. Tropical low 90P is over the Coral Sea being steered eastward along the subtropical ridge. It is currently in an neutral to unfavourable environment, but this could improve early next week around the Vanuatu, Fijian region.
4. Tropical low 92P over the Gulf of Carpentaria is a low chance it could develop near Far North Queensland early next week.
